Gala Goal Announced

November 4, 2024 – Sulphur Springs, TX – The Hopkins County Health Care Foundation’s Annual Gala has become part of the fabric of Hopkins County.   Many locals affectionately call it the adult prom.  It is a fun evening that gives attendees the chance to dress up and enjoy dinner, a live band, friends, and dancing. Foundation Sets 2025 Funding Priorities

November 3, 2024 – Sulphur Springs, TX – The Hopkins County Health Care Foundation has set their 2025 funding priorities.  Both projects will have a positive impact on the health of Hopkins County citizens. Foundation Announces New Breast Cancer Support Group

November 3, 2024 – Sulphur Springs, TX – October is Breast Cancer Awareness Month, but for many, breast cancer isn’t a topic relegated to a month.  It is a fight, a reality, or a new diagnosis.  For those women, a local breast cancer support group has been formed.
